Are you facing challenges with your Bendigo Bank app, disrupting your banking experience? Don’t worry; we’ve got you covered with effective solutions to address and resolve any issues you may encounter. Follow these steps to get your Bendigo Bank app up and running smoothly:

1. Check for Updates:

Step 1: Start by ensuring you have the latest version of the Bendigo Bank app installed on your device.

Step 2: Open the Google Play Store (for Android) or the App Store (for iOS).

Step 3: Search for “Bendigo Bank app” and navigate to the app page.

Step 4: If updates are available, tap on the “Update” button to install them.

Step 5: Updating the app can often fix bugs and improve its performance.

2. Clear Cache and Data:

Step 1: Clearing cache and data can help resolve underlying issues with the Bendigo Bank app.

Step 2: On Android: Tap and hold the Bendigo Bank app icon, then select “App Info.”

Step 3: Tap on “Clear All Data” and confirm to clear cache and data.

Step 4: Note that clearing data will log you out, so be prepared to log back in afterward.

3. Reinstall the App:

Step 1: If clearing cache and data doesn’t resolve the issue, consider reinstalling the Bendigo Bank app.

Step 2: Uninstall the Bendigo Bank app from your device.

Step 3: Visit the app store and reinstall the Bendigo Bank app.

Step 4: Reinstalling the app can eliminate any glitches that may be causing the problem.

4. Wait it Out:

If none of the above solutions work, the issue may be temporary, possibly due to server problems or system maintenance. In such cases, wait for a few hours and then try using the app again later.
